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 28, Chessfield Park, Amersham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£815,618 and a rental value of £2,835 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£722,404 and a rental value of £2,511 per month.

Energy Efficiency
28, Chessfield Park, Amersham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 25 Mar 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 28, Chessfield Park, Amersham was last sold on 15th October 2024 for £800,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since October 2024, the market for similar properties has dropped by 4.8%.
